Soluble Organic Matter Content And Stoichiometric Traits Of CNP In Foliage And Litter Of Three Subtropical Forests

In order to understand the quantity and regularity of dissolved organic matter(DOM)release from fresh leaves and litter layer and their stoichiometric characteristics of carbon(C),nitrogen(N)and phosphorus(P),an investigation of ecological mechanism of DOM leaching was conducted in three different subtropical forests.Fresh foliage,undecomposed litter(L layer)and semi-decomposed litter(F layer)were collected from the mid-aged Castanopsis sclerophylla,old-growth Castanopsis sclerophylla forests and Cunninghamia lanceolata plantation.A simulated leaching experiment was conducted in the laboratory.The objectives of the study was to reveal the variation patterns of DOM,SUVA and pH of leaching solution from the different components in the three forest stands.The results obtained are as follows.(1)In mid-aged Castanopsis sclerophylla stand,the average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P in fresh leaves were,respectively,1197.43 mg·kg-1,25.62 mg·kg-1,and 1.58 mg·kg-1 within 11 times of leaching,and the cumulative amounts were 13171.71 mg·kg-1 for DOC,281.77 mg·kg-1 for DON and 17.42 mg·kg-1 for DOP.In the litter layer,the average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P were,respectively,479.58 mg·kg-1,20.29 mg·kg-1 and 1.97 mg·kg-1,with the accumulations were 10550.68 mg·kg-1,20.29 mg·kg-1 and 1.97 mg·kg-1.After the leaching of Castanopsis sclerophylla forest through different layers,The mean concentrations and accumulations were decreased for DOC and DON,while was increased for mean DOP concentration and decreased significantly for DOP accumulations.The contents of DOC and DON in the leaching solution were significantly different in the early leaching period than in the middle and late leaching periods(p<0.05),and the contents of DOP were significantly different in the early and late leaching periods than in the middle leaching periods(p<0.05).The average value of SUVA was F layer(2.56)>L layer(2.03)>fresh leaves(1.76),and the maximum value of DOC and SUVA did not appear in the same leaching times.The SUVA value of the seventh leaching solution of fresh leaves,L layer and F layer was significantly different from other leaching times(p<0.01).The average pH values of leaching solution from fresh leaves,L layer and F layer were 6.55,6.66 and 6.63,respectively.The pH values of the leaching solution in the later leaching stage of fresh leaves,L layer and F layer was significantly different from that in other leaching times(p<0.01).(2)In old-gowth Castanopsis eyrei stand,the average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P from fresh leaves were 1292.75 mg·kg-1,22.96 mg·kg-1 and 0.24 mg·kg-1,within 11 times of leaching,and the cumulative amounts were 14220.23 mg·kg-1,252.58 mg·kg-1 and 2.64 mg·kg-1,respectively.The average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P from litter layers were 570.89 mg·kg-1,31.28 mg·kg-1,1.96 mg·kg-1,and the accumulations were 570.89 mg·kg-1,688.15 mg·kg-1,and 43.06 mg·kg-1,respectively.The average concentration and the cumulative amount of DOC decreased during successive leaching,while DON and DOP were increased.Under the same leaching conditions,DOCs from fresh leaves and F layer in the early leaching stage were significantly different from those in the middle and late leaching stages(p<0.05).However,in the middle stage of leaching,DOC from L layer was significantly different from that in the earlier and later stages(p<0.05).The DON and DOP from fresh leaves,L layer and F layer were significantly different in the middle stage than in early and late stages of leaching(p<0.05).The average value of SUVA was F layer>L layer.The SUVA value of fresh leaf leaching solution was significantly different from that of other leaching time(p<0.01).The average value of SUVA was F layer>L layer>fresh leaves,the SUVA value of fresh leaf leaching solution in the second leaching time was significantly different from other leaching times(p<0.01),the SUVA values for L and F layers in the seventh leaching time was significantly different from other leaching times(p<0.05).The pH values in fresh leaves,L and F layers were all slightly acidic at the beginning of leaching(pH<6.0)and neutral at the end of leaching(pH=7.0 or so).The pH values of fresh leaves,L and F layers at the later stage of leaching were significantly different than at middle stage(p<0.05).(3)In Cunninghamia lanceolata plantation,the average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P in the fresh leaves were 1855.97 mg·kg-1,6.51mg·kg-1 and 0.44 mg·kg-1,the accumulations were 21405.69 mg·kg-1,71.63 mg·kg-1 and 4.84 mg·kg-1,respectively.The average concentrations of DOC,DON and DOP in litter layers were 1531.85 mg·kg-1,18.95 mg·kg-1,and 0.40 mg·kg-1,and the accumulations were 33700.75 mg·kg-1,416.86 mg·kg-1,and 8.88 mg·kg-1,respectively.There was a significant difference in DOC between the middle stage and the earlier and the latter stages(p<0.05).However,the difference in DOC in L and F layers were significant betweem the latter stage and other stages(p<0.05).In the leaching process,SUVA value of F layer was much higher than the others.SUVA values of fresh leaves and F layer at the later stage of leaching were significantly different with other leaching stages(p<0.01).The SUVA value in L layer in the middle stage was significantly different with other stages(p<0.05).The average pH value was:L layer(6.55)>F layer(6.35)>fresh leaves(6.00).The pH values were significantly different between the later stage and other stages(p<0.05).(4)The loss rate of N and P in C.sclerophylla forest was higher than that of C loss.The loss rate of P and N was higher than that of C in L and F layers.This indicates that N is easier to be leached in fresh leaves in C.sclerophylla forest.However,the P had strong retention capacity.In L and F layers,P is easier to be leached out and N has stronger retention capacity.In C.eyrei forest,the P loss rate of fresh leaves was higher than C and N loss rates.The N loss rate of L layer was approximately the same as P loss rate,while was greater than C loss.The C,N and P loss rates in F layer were approximately similar.This indicated that P was more likely to be leached out in fresh leaves,while N and P in litter layers were more likely to be leached out.In Cunninghamia lanceolata forest,N loss rate from fresh leaves was greater than C,and P loss rate was greater than its mass loss rate.The P loss rate in L layer was higher than C and N loss rate.The N and P loss rate in F layer is greater than C loss rate.(5)The average content of C in the three stands was C.lanceolata(505.34 g·kg-1)>C eyrei(453.29 g·kg-1)>C.sclerophylla(452.76 g·kg-1),and the average content of N was C.eyrei(11.69 g·kg-1)>C.sclerophylla(11.29 g·kg-1)>C.lanceolata(11.11 g·kg-1).The average P content showed C.lanceolata(0.46 g·kg-1)>C.sclerophylla(0.44 g·kg-1)and C.eyrei(0.43 g·kg-1).The average ratios of C:N,C:P,N:P in fresh leaves and L layer were basically expressed as C:P>C:N>N:P.C:N ratio was C.lanceolata forest>C.eyrei>C.sclerophylla;C:P and N:P ratios,all are C.sclerophylla>C.eyrei>C.lanceolata forest.The C:N ratio of L layer is C.lanceolata>C.sclerophylla>C.eyrei,the C:P ratio is C.lanceolata>C.eyrei>C.sclerophylla,the N:P ratio is C.eyrei>C.sclerophylla>C.lanceolata.The average ratios of C:N,C:P,N:P in F layer were basically expressed as C:P>C:N>N:P.However,in C.eyrei forest,expressed as N:P>C:N.The C:N ratio is C.sclerophylla>C eyrei>C.lanceolata,C:P and N:P ratio were both as C.eyrei>C.sclerophylla>C.lanceolata.
